Coquille resident Heagy named Laker of the YearAs a lifelong educator, Coquille resident Dorothy Heagy says “Education is my mission; my passion in life.” Heagy’s support of lifelong learning and Southwestern Oregon Community College make her a fitting selection as the second Laker of the Year. The Southwestern Foundation recognized Heagy with that award recently at its Annual Dinner. A long-time teacher, Heagy taught students from kindergarten through doctorate level studies in her six-decade career in Pennsylvania, Ohio, Hawaii, Washington and Oregon. From 1971 until her retirement in 1981, Heagy taught in the Coquille Public School District. As an advocate of lifelong learning, Heagy also has devoted a great deal of her time, energy and enthusiasm to Southwestern in a variety of capacities. She has served Southwestern as an instructor, a College Board of Education member from 1992 to 2001 and as a Foundation Board member for about eight years. Her involvement with the Foundation included establishing its first Charitable Remainder Trust. The Laker of the Year, awarded annually, honored Heagy from nominations submitted by the Foundation Board. She received a plaque for her contributions to Southwestern and the Foundation at the second-annual Foundation membership meeting on June 7. Heagy was modest in her comments about receiving the award. “It’s a very flattering award,” she said. “I’m very happy but I think there have been other people who have done more.”
